    I gave it up after the tenth and checked early to see the Sox had pulled it out.

    During the game, I found it frustrating that major league hitters would take called 3rd strikes over the plate with men on third and one out. Both Leon aand Beni did it in successive innings. What can they be thinking. Then there was the situation where Beni was given the gift of being hit by a pitch to lead off the 10th. The options for JF were to send Beni, to hit and run, to bunt or to let Beni stay at first and have Pedroia swing away. The worst outcome in the situation would be a double play. It was a tough decision, with a good catcher and attentive pitcher a steal had a questionable probability of working. Pedroia had been one of our bright spots in the batting order. It turned out Pedroia hit into the double play and Hanley followed with a double. Before it took place, I and the BJs expected a steal attempt. What would you have done?

    Those calling for Hanley's trade can see that he still has value for us and should stay in the 4 or 5 spot as Moon has said. Moreland is in my view pulling away from the ball and he hits the ball to left too often. He did that last night on a changeup down the middle, one he should be able to pull. He needs to find himself and should be temporarily out of the lineup or moved further back in the order. Marerro is not a viable offensive player for us. Lin can play infield utility positions as well and has a better plate approach. Devers might help the club now or they had better find another 3rd base candidate while the club is still in the lead.

    Time is running short DD. I didn't want Frazier either although Robertson might have helped. There are still options out there. I would keep Travis if at all possible. He is still a young player and may blossom next year.
